New SMRT Space DC/DC Converter Family from Interpoint

Redmond, Wash. – July 20, 2004 – Interpoint, part of the Electronics Group of Crane Aerospace & Electronics, a Crane Co. segment announced a new Space DC/DC converter family, the SMRT. The SMRT products all have wide input voltage ranges and are available as single, dual, triple or quad outputs. “The SMRT is a new generation of space products with a huge amount of flexibility to meet most customers’ requirements. They include a number of “firsts” for Interpoint which add value to the customer: fully internal filters, low temperature operation for deep space applications and a variety of radiation level guarantees,” said Lou Bieck, president of the Electronics Group of Crane Aerospace & Electronics. 

The SMRT converters incorporate 2 independent feedback loops in a two-phased flyback design. Each set of outputs is isolated from each other and the input voltage can easily be changed for nominal 28V, 50V, 70V or 100V input bus use.  Screening levels of O, H or K (referenced to MIL-STD-883 and MIL-PRF-38534) are offered. The SMRT is available now with prices starting at $5,000 each in quantities of 100
